Pre-Trial Services Corp Executive Administrative Assistant in Rochester, New York

OBJECTIVE OF THE POSITION: To provide confidential clerical/support services to the Administration of Pre-Trial Services CorporationDUTIES OF THE POSITION: •Perform confidential support/clerical duties as directed by the Administration of PTSC•Record and retrieve financial information from both manual and automated systems•Assist in the preparation of financial statements•Prepare and electronically enter the payroll and fringe benefit information into the agency financial software•Utilize websites to input and manage fringe benefits and payroll•Reconcile bank statements•Prepare bills for approval and prepare checks for payment•Act as the Team Leader for the support staff, coordinating coverage for the Administrative Assistants•Utilize computer for word processing software for generating documents and communications•Answer phones and generate messages•Greet and direct visitors and clients•Processing incoming and outgoing mail for administrative staff•Utilize automated management information and manual systems to generate reports, retrieve data, manage electronic communications and update calendaring•Reproduce and distribute documents and communications•Process personnel and benefit related forms as directed and distribute to appropriate designees•Provide support services for the Board of Directors’ activities as directed by the Executive Director•Responsible for agency inventory and management of supplies and equipment•Responsible for processing program fees and maintaining records of such fees•Function as a member of the agency Support Team•Perform other tasks as deemed appropriate by the administration of Pre-Trial Services CorporationMINIMUM REQUIREMENTS/PERFORMANCE STANDARDS:•Must demonstrate broad cultural sensitivity and a non-judgmental approach to clients•Must have related experience in a financial record keeping, personnel and/or general administrative support position•Must have automated management information system experience and skills•Must have strong clerical skills in typing, data entry, filing and project managementIN AN ADMINISTRATIVE/FINANCIAL SUPPORT POSITION, HAS:•Demonstrated ability to manage confidential information in an appropriate manner•Demonstrated the ability to organize and accomplish tasks in a timely and accurate manner•Demonstrated the ability to manage multiple assignments and projects successfully by meeting deadlines and accomplishing tasks error free•Demonstrated initiative in identifying tasks to be completed and in managing assignments•Demonstrated the ability to work well within a team oriented environment and under director from multiple sources•Demonstrated ability to consistently and accurately assess and define relevant information in complex situations and generate multiple options for action•Demonstrated ability to work well with others and deal with conflicts helpfullyBachelor’s Degree with a minimum of 1 year relevant experience in accounting and/or a related field ORAssociates Degree with a minimum of 3 years of relevant experience in accounting and/or a related fieldORSecretarial/Bookkeeping training from an accredited training institution with 5 years of relevant experience in financial record keeping, administrative secretarial support and general office duties.ORAny combination of training and experience as deemed equivalent by the Executive Director

Minimum Salary: 21.00 Maximum Salary: 28.00 Salary Unit: Hourly
